Senator Eggman Presents Social Work Month Resolution During Senate Floor Session

On March 28, 2022 Senator Eggman presented SR 69, a declaration of March as Social Work Month in California. Senator Eggman has previously advocated for Social Work Title Protection and continued to keep the issue at the forefront of the conversation. The resolution has been passed and can be viewed at California’s Legislative Information. Thank you, Senator Eggman, for your service.
